Ingredients
- 2 cups of flour
- 1 cup butter at room temperature
- 2 eggs
- ½ cup of milk
- ½ teaspoon vanilla
- ½ cup Glace cherries(red and green), chopped
- 3 tablespoons of liqueur
Directions
- Preheat the oven at 180° Celsius.
- In a mixing bowl, add butter and sugar and mix.
- Add eggs and vanilla and whisk/or use an electric mixer.
- Add flour and milk in two increments and mix.
- Add in the liqueur and cherries and mix with a spatula.
- Pour the batter into a greased and dusted pan and b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
- Cool on the wire rack for about 10 minutes, then remove from the pan and let it cool completely.
- Enjoy.
